The Inspection Process

The initial assessment by a pest control expert is crucial. This phase typically involves:

  • A thorough examination of the interior and exterior of the property.
  • Identification of spider species present and assessment of their potential threat.
  • Locating nesting sites, common pathways, and conducive conditions that attract or harbor spiders.
  • Discussion with the homeowner or business owner to understand concerns and observe areas of frequent spider activity.

This meticulous inspection, often conducted in homes from Kaimuki to Aiea, ensures that the subsequent treatment plan is precise and effective.

Treatment and Removal Methods

Once the inspection is complete, a customized treatment plan is developed. This can include a variety of methods, often employed in combination:

  • Targeted Application of Insecticides: Professionals use specialized, EPA-approved products applied strategically to harborage areas, entry points, and areas of high spider activity. This ensures maximum effectiveness with minimal risk to residents and pets when applied by trained technicians.
  • Web Removal: Manual removal of existing webs and egg sacs is an important part of the process, disrupting the spider life cycle.
  • Dusting and Barrier Treatments: Application of dusts in voids and cracks, and barrier treatments around the perimeter of the property, are often used to create long-lasting protection.
  • Environmental Modifications: Professionals may also advise on changes to the property’s environment, such as sealing cracks, reducing clutter, and managing outdoor lighting, to make it less attractive to spiders.

The goal is not just to kill the spiders present but to prevent future infestations, ensuring long-term peace of mind for Honolulu residents.

How to spot spiders in Honolulu

The first signs of spiders in the Honolulu area homes: webs in corners, eaves, or basements, egg sacs attached to webs in sheltered spots, and more sightings indoors in fall as spiders seek warmth. Spotting these early makes treatment faster and less disruptive.

How Spider Control works in Honolulu

A professional Spider Control in Honolulu typically means eliminating webs and egg sacs, perimeter and harborage-area spraying, reducing exterior lighting that attracts prey insects, and sealing entry gaps. Locally, most spiders are harmless, but brown recluse and black widow bites require medical attention — and both are more common in cluttered or undisturbed spaces in older homes.

Local spiders timing

Spiders are active most of the year in the Honolulu area, with indoor pressure increasing in the cooler months.

Honolulu prevention tips

To keep spiders from returning in the Honolulu area: seal gaps around windows and pipes, reduce clutter in storage areas, and cut or switch exterior lighting to minimize the prey insects that attract spiders.

Can I treat spiders myself in Honolulu?

Store-bought products can help somewhat, but often fall short — contact sprays kill on-contact but spiders quickly avoid treated surfaces; a pro addresses the harborage areas and cuts back the prey-insect population that attracts them. Getting a pro in means treating the source, not just what you can see.

Who handles spiders treatment costs in Honolulu?

For renters in Honolulu: Hawaii's warranty of habitability generally makes the landlord responsible for treating spiders not caused by the tenant — put any notice in writing. spiders entering through structural gaps are a building-maintenance pest issue; a recurring infestation driven by structural conditions is a landlord habitability concern.
